**Re: quota enforcement in meterd**

The per-tenant token bucket looks right, but refill happens on read, so an idle tenant's first burst after a quiet hour gets a full bucket plus accrued refill — double-dipping. Clamp accrual to bucket capacity. Also: the overage grace window should be config, not a literal, since Fennick-tier tenants negotiate different limits. One more nit — log quota denials at warn, not error. Defaults I'd suggest are below.

tuning table, kajog-kawef:
PRIORITIES = {
    "kelox": 870,
    "kasix": 89,
    "eliax": 988,
}

Capacity note: Bramblekey bloom filter

The bloom filter sits in front of the key-value store to short-circuit lookups for absent keys. At current ingest rates the false-positive target of 1% holds until roughly 40M entries, after which we must resize. Sizing math and the rebuild cadence depend on the constants that follow.

tuning table, yajog-yahof:
BUDGETS = {
    "lamvan": 303,
    "wenox": 460,
    "fenvan": 525,
}

Action item from the Lanterbury outage review: flaky DNS resolution between the Corvid edge nodes and the internal resolver caused intermittent 502s for six hours. Owner: Priya's team. We're adding a local caching layer with jittered refresh and a stricter negative-cache TTL, plus retry backoff at the client. Target completion is next sprint. The agreed resolver tuning constants are listed below.

tuning constants:
QUOTAS = {
    "druwyn": 5,
    "holix": 5,
    "zorath": 5,
    "holwyn": 10,
}

### Item 14 — Spreadsheet export memory

Verify the Korvid export service streams rows instead of materializing full workbooks in memory. Prior incident: 40k-row export OOM'd the worker pool. Check: chunk size capped at 500 rows; temp files cleaned on failure; peak RSS under 512 MB in the load test suite; no `toArray()` calls on the result cursor. Reviewer must confirm the benchmark run attached to the PR. Any deviation requires written approval from the export owner identified directly below.

account owner for tawef-yadug: Jorius Normir Silath